- •«Компьютерные сети и периферийные устройства»
- •Казань 2011 Содержание
- •1.1 Подпрограммные архитектуры и устройства………………………………………….3
- •I.Подпрограммные архитектуры и устройства
- •1.2 Символьные и блочные устройства
- •1.3 Физические и логические виртуальные устройства
- •2.Периферийное устройство компьютера и аппаратное обеспечение компьютера
- •2.1 Устройства ввода
- •2.2 Устройство с клавиатурным вводом
- •2.3 Манипуляторы
- •3. Устройства сканирования
- •3.1 Сканеры
- •3.2 Характеристики сканеров
- •4.Устройства вывода
Федеральное агентство связи
Казанский электротехникум связи
Отчет по практике:
«Компьютерные сети и периферийные устройства»
Выполнили студенты 305 группы:
Фардутдинов А.Р.
.
.
Проверили:
Казань 2011 Содержание
I.Подпрограммные архитектуры и устройства
1.1 Подпрограммные архитектуры и устройства………………………………………….3
1.2 Символьные и блочные устройства…………………………………………………….3
1.3 Физические и логические виртуальные устройства…………………………………...3
2.Периферийное устройство компьютера и аппаратное обеспечение компьютера………………………………………………………...…………4
2.1 Устройства ввода………………………………………………………………………...4
2.2 Устройства с клавиатурным вводом……………………................................................4
2.3 Манипуляторы…………………………………………………………………………...4
3. Устройства сканирования……………………………………………….20
3.1 Сканеры…………………………………………………………………………………..22
I.Подпрограммные архитектуры и устройства
1.1 Подпрограммные архитектуры
Под программной архитектурой понимается совокупность тех структурных особенностей, которые влияют на работу программ с устройствами. Например, форма разъема для подключения устройства не входит в его архитектуру.
Как правило вместе с устройством поставляется его контроллер (адаптер), содержащий электронные схемы управления устройством.
Конструктивно контроллер может представлять собой плату вставляемую в разъем шины компьютера, либо может быть расположен в корпусе устройства. В любом случае программы работают с устройством через контроллер, а поэтому с точки зрения архитектуры нет разделения между понятиями устройства и контроллер устройства.
Классификация периферийных устройств может быть выполнена по различным признакам.
Устройства последовательного и произвольного доступа. Для последовательного устройства характерно наличие определённого естественного порядка данных, при этом обработка данных в ином порядке, либо не возможна, либо крайне затруднена.
К устройствам последовательного доступа можно отнести: клавиатуру, мышь, принтер, модем.
Для устройств произвольного доступа возможно обращение к разным порциям данных в любом порядке, причем эффективная работа не зависит от порядка обращения: жесткий диск, оптический диск, мониторы и т.д..
1.2 Символьные и блочные устройства
Для символьных устройств наименьшей порцией вводимых и выводимых данных является 1 байт. Для некоторых символьных устройств можно выполнить ввод или вывод любого требуемого количества байт.
Для блочных устройств наименьшей порцией ввода/вывода, выполняемого за одно обращение устройства является 1 блок равный как правило 2k байт. Типичным размером блока может быть 512 байт, 1 кбайт, 4 кбайт и т.д., в зависимости от устройства, например магнитные ленты, магнитные диски.
Блочная архитектура обуславливается особенностями используемой среды, кроме того блочный ввод/вывод данных более эффективен для высокоскоростных устройств, поскольку при этом уменьшается относительная доля времени расходуемое на подготовительное и заключающее обращение операции при каждом обращении к устройству.